Uneven Teeth
If you have uneven teeth, you can straighten them with orthodontic treatments. Uneven teeth can trigger different problems, consisting of problem in cleaning them appropriately, raised threat of dental cavity and gum tissue illness, and even problems with speech or chewing.
Orthodontic therapies, such as dental braces or clear aligners, can aid deal with the placement of your teeth. Braces are made from steel braces and cords that apply gentle pressure to move your teeth right into their proper setting. Clear aligners, on the other hand, are customized plastic trays that slowly shift your teeth.
Both options work in straightening out jagged teeth, however the choice relies on your certain needs and choices. Consulting with an orthodontist will certainly aid establish the most effective treatment plan for you.
Congestion
Are your teeth jammed, causing pain and trouble in maintaining good dental hygiene? Overcrowding is a common orthodontic problem that occurs when there wants space in your mouth for all your teeth to fit properly. This can result in a variety of concerns, from uneven teeth to attack problems.
Luckily, there are a number of reliable remedies to fix congestion:
1. ** Tooth removal **: In some cases, eliminating several teeth might be necessary to produce even more room in your mouth.
2. ** Development home appliances **: These devices are used to expand the arch of your mouth, permitting your teeth to line up correctly.
3. ** Orthodontic therapy **: Dental braces or clear aligners can slowly change your teeth into their correct placements, eliminating congestion and improving your smile.
Addressing congestion is essential not only for visual reasons yet additionally for your total oral health and wellness. Speak with an orthodontist to establish the very best strategy for your certain situation.

Bite Concerns
Remedying bite concerns is essential for correct alignment and feature of your teeth. If you're experiencing bite concerns, it is very important to look for orthodontic therapy to deal with the issue.
Right here are 3 typical bite concerns and how they can be fixed:
1. Overbite: An overbite takes place when your upper front teeth overlap substantially with your reduced front teeth. This can lead to problems with attacking and chewing. Orthodontic treatment, such as dental braces or Invisalign, can assist correct an overbite by gradually moving the teeth into their correct position.
2. Underbite: An underbite is when your lower front teeth stick out in front of your upper teeth. This can affect the look of your smile and can trigger difficulties with biting and eating. Orthodontic therapy may involve making use of dental braces or various other devices to move the lower teeth back and align them effectively with the top teeth.
3. Crossbite: A crossbite is when your top teeth sit inside your lower teeth when you attack down. This can create uneven wear on the teeth and can lead to jaw pain. Orthodontic treatment for a crossbite might include using braces or other devices to realign the teeth and correct the bite.
